
Opie Scores Two in Team North Win
February 21, 2011 - North American Hockey League (NAHL)
Traverse City North Stars News Release
ANN ARBOR - Tim Opie scored a pair of goals - including the eventual game-winner - on Monday in the second day of action at the NAHL Top Prospects Tournament at the Ann Arbor Ice Cube, lifting Team North past their West Division counterparts.
Opie (Troy, MI/TC North Stars) scored his first marker 11:49 into the second period, and issued the very next tally as well with 2:20 to play in the frame. Michael Szmatula (Commerce Twp., MI/Lansing Capitals U18) drew his first all-star assist, setting up Opie's second score. Travis White (Sterling Heights, MI/TC North Stars) registered a shot on net.
Team North, now 1-1, wrap up their all-star slate on Tuesday, facing off again Team Central in a 12:15 p.m. affair. All four divisional squads are 1-1 two-thirds of the way through the event.
Opie, Szmatula, White, and the rest of the North Stars travel to Flint to take on the Warriors this Wednesday before returning to Centre ICE Arena next weekend for a two-game series with Motor City beginning on Saturday, Feb. 26 at 7 p.m. and concluding Sunday (Feb. 27) afternoon at 1 p.m.
